How can I track calories burned during a workout?

Tracking the calories burned during a workout is crucial for anyone interested in fitness, health, and weight management. Understanding how many calories you burn can help you set realistic fitness goals, monitor your progress, and make informed dietary choices. There are several methods available for tracking calories burned, and exploring these options can be quite beneficial for your fitness journey.

One of the most straightforward ways to calculate calories burned is through the use of fitness apps. Many apps available today, such as MyFitnessPal, offer built-in calculators that consider factors like your weight, age, gender, and workout intensity. These apps allow you to log your workouts in real-time, providing you with a rough estimate of the calories youve burned. Another popular method involves using wearable technology, such as fitness trackers or smartwatches. These devices monitor your heart rate, activity levels, and even your sleep patterns. Most wearables come equipped with algorithms that calculate calories burned based on your heart rate and the type of exercise you are doing. For instance, a higher heart rate while running will typically result in more calories burned compared to walking. Caloric burn can also be estimated using metabolic equivalents (METs). METs are a way to express the energy cost of physical activities as a multiple of the resting metabolic rate. For example, activities like running or cycling have higher MET values compared to walking. You can use online MET calculators to find out how many calories you burn based on the activity type, your weight, and the duration of the activity. This method can be very effective for understanding the energy expenditure of various workouts.

If you prefer a more hands-on approach, you can calculate calories burned manually using formulas that take into account your weight and the type of exercise youre doing. The general formula for calculating calories burned during exercise is:

Calories burned = METs × weight in kg × duration in hours.

This method requires a bit more effort but can be quite accurate if you know the MET value of the activity you are performing.

It’s important to remember that not all workouts are created equal, and the intensity of your workout can significantly impact the number of calories burned. High-Intensity Interval Training (HIIT), for instance, can lead to a higher calorie burn compared to steady-state cardio. This is due to the ‘afterburn effect,’ where your body continues to burn calories post-exercise to recover from the intense activity. So, incorporating a variety of workout styles may optimize your calorie-burning potential.
